Ice and Slice Newtown

October 20th 2006 05:17
I’ve been to Ice and Slice several times now and I have to say it’s definitely one of my favourite pizza places in Newtown.

Ice and Slice
135 King Street
Newtown, NSW 2042
(02) 9516 4595

http://www.iceandslice.com.au

Check out www.iceandslice.com.au for better pics



Having been established on King Street for a while Ice and Slice has developed a good reputation from the masses of passing trade that come to Newtown’s restaurant district looking for somewhere good to eat.

On the last occasion I visited this restaurant we had a very large group so we got the set menu at $26 a head. This was excellent as it saved me the effort of choosing one of the many tantalising toppings and instead having the opportunity to sample several different varieties. I had two slices of the tandoori pizza which was innovative and tasty. It included thin slices of tandoori chicken with dollops of yoghurt on top. I also had a vegetarian slice and something with big fat prawns on it. The pizzas are all thin crusts and very cheesy just the way I like it. None of my favourite topping when I share with others though- anchovies!

The set menu also includes garlic bread, salad and gelato, so you’ll definitely be full for your dime. If you’re feeling the pinch a single gourmet pizza will usually set you back about $15 or so and is usually about the size of a large dinner plate.




The range of gelato is not as extensive as some of the competitors in Newtown but what they do have is so creamy and so flavoursome it slides down your throat like liquid heaven. I chose a scoop of café latte flavoured gelato and one of sugared almonds, but there are also several fruity flavours to choose from. The drinks are also something to be beheld. The ice chocolates and coffees are mammoth with scoops of gelato floating amongst various syrups and there is also a range of similarly decadent alcoholic beverages. Share with a kind friend as these are humungous!

The awesome food is not the only attraction of ice and slice. It’s large, pleasant and clean so it can accommodate big groups like ours was. There’s also a cute little outdoor area lit with fairy lights that you can request for a more intimate option. There are several helpful and more importantly attractive wait staff who will be there to take your order and your stares. The atmosphere on a weekend night is usually busy but friendly.
